Output 39b8845c5af8888084dd151fe2b599d38fd325108c3928ca6825ab53bacae8a7:1

value
11166681
script pubkey
OP_0 OP_PUSHBYTES_20 31c53a08a2d9753070d19a6bf59a25eb9b2bb0e6
address
ltc1qx8zn5z9zm96nqux3nf4ltx39awdjhv8xl7a7t6
transaction
39b8845c5af8888084dd151fe2b599d38fd325108c3928ca6825ab53bacae8a7
spent
true